Transaction 25eb67fa340fe0566884463825e16c083f660cf50edd8df664b0c81a40e51f7f

1 Input
2 Outputs
  • 25eb67fa340fe0566884463825e16c083f660cf50edd8df664b0c81a40e51f7f:0
  • value  455762
    address  37ZSRCQAhRfKjPwEGR6umGsqqZtFFb3j2j
  • 25eb67fa340fe0566884463825e16c083f660cf50edd8df664b0c81a40e51f7f:1
  • value  9953
    address  1E6wu5aMKPHSzZ8oCVWV2TeNkHaR9Z7Hpd